What should I see and do during my getaway to Kathmandu?
After you've enjoyed the view from your private balcony, get your walking shoes on and hit the streets to explore Kathmandu. Get started by checking out Narayanhity Palace Museum, Durbar Marg, and Ballys Casino. A few other sites and attractions to discover include Garden of Dreams, Asan Bazaar, and Indra Chowk.
